====== gLPI agent====== [[glpi:glpi|{{ :glpi:icon.jpg?120|}}]] ===== context===== dit document beschrijft de installatie van de gLPI agent op Linux ===== stappen===== - [[https://github.com/glpi-project/glpi-agent|download]] de recentste versie van Github - voer uit: perl glpi-agent--linux-installer.pl --type=all --logfile=/var/log/glpi-agent.log --cron --debug=1 --runnow --server=http://glpi.legoland.net/marketplace/glpiinventory/ - dit installeert met onderstaande waarden: - alle plugins - /home of user profiles worden niet gescand - inventory modules starten met een time-out op 30 minuten - HTTP requests op poort 62354 toelaten vanaf de GLPI server - glpi-agent starten als een service (TCP/62354) - server: URL van gLPI server - install cronjob (hourly) - debug level 1 - logfile in ''/var/log/glpi-agent.log'' - maakt na installatie contact met server. - **FW**: voeg de hostname toe aan de groep: ''hg_glpi_agent'' - start de agent: systemctl start glpi-agent ===== bestanden ===== ==== configuratie ==== * /etc/glpi-agent/ * agent.cfg:centrale config * conf.d: extra config bestanden * /var/log/glpi-agent.log: logbestand * /usr/share/glpi-agent/: database bestanden (oa **sysobject.ids**) ===== service ===== * systemctl start|atop|restart glpi-agent ===== Toolbox ===== * activeer dan [[toolbox|gLPI tooblox]], als agent ook inventory taken moet uitvoeren. ===== verwijderen ===== glpi-agent--linux-installer.pl --uninstall ===== meer info ===== [[https://glpi-agent.readthedocs.io/en/latest/installation/|ReadTheDocs]] {{tag>glpi}}